*1

The CAT button is available only when the XM
tuner is connected.

*2

Available only when playing back on this unit.

*3

When an optional MD unit is connected.

*4

Available only when an optional Sony portable
device is connected to AUX IN terminal of the unit.
When you connect a Sony portable device and CD/
MD unit(s) at the same time, use the AUX IN
selector.

*5

When an optional CD/MD unit is connected.

*6

Available only when an MP3 file is played.

Note
If the display disappears by pressing

(OFF)

, the unit

cannot be operated with the card remote commander
unless

(SOURCE)

on the unit is pressed, or a disc is

inserted to activate the unit first.
